Research on the influence of forced oil supply at roller end face on rotary piston compressor performance

Abstract: Leakage inside the compressor pump is one of the main factors affecting compressor performance. Through simulation of the performance of rotary compressors, it is found that piston end face leakage has a significant impact on compressor performance. At the same time, it is analyzed that the reduction of piston end face clearance can reduce end leakage and greatly improve compressor performance. Therefore, a piston end face forced oil supply sealing structure is proposed to reduce the actual leakage clearance of piston end face during compressor operation and improve compressor performance. Based on theoretical oil supply pressure, volumetric flow rate, and fluid simulation analysis, the structural form and dimensions of the forced oil supply seal were determined, ensuring the effectiveness of the forced oil supply seal structure without affecting the reliability of the compressor. Finally, it was confirmed through experiments that the forced oil supply seal structure of the piston end face can improve the performance of the compressor.
